Output e76daaaf3e1a62a99b3fa069cad4c8a792709148639d63e93b65fc250ca7b3f8: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c06a462feeaebb3bae106a4bbe4e71b0ac4e77 OP_EQUAL
address
3NBPnkYhjA4whuLZQLhKTXAfaLgNWFirEe
transaction
e76daaaf3e1a62a99b3fa069cad4c8a792709148639d63e93b65fc250ca7b3f8
confirmations
380911
spent
true